HTML Table is a structured way to display tabular data on web pages using HTML table elements. It provides a grid-like structure with rows and columns, making it easy to organize and present data in a clear, readable format. HTML Tables are widely used for displaying data on websites and web applications, offering a native way to represent structured information in a visually organized manner.
HTML Tables are ideal for:
Data Display: Presenting structured data on web pages, such as product catalogs, pricing tables, and data reports
Layout: Creating grid-based layouts for content organization and alignment
Data Comparison: Comparing multiple data points in a structured, easy-to-read format
Responsive Design: Creating responsive data displays that adapt to different screen sizes
Structured: Clear organization of data in rows and columns with semantic meaning
Accessible: Built-in accessibility features with proper ARIA attributes and semantic markup
Stylable: Can be styled with CSS for custom appearance and responsive behavior
Responsive: Can be made responsive for different screen sizes using modern CSS techniques
Complex Layouts: Not ideal for complex page layouts, as tables should be used for tabular data only
Mobile Challenges: Can be difficult to display on small screens without proper responsive design techniques
Limited Interactivity: Basic interactivity without JavaScript, requiring additional code for advanced features